News #7: ‘Firebreath’ the debut video from Caitlin Stubbs

Caitlin Stubbs is an artist who has been on our radar since somofitistrue picked up her debut EP back in April. Hailing from Brighton UK, Caitlin possesses an amazing ethereal voice which perfectly accompanies the strings, guitars and piano that dominate the sound of the EP. It is atmospheric stuff with flourishes of trumpet adding to the jazz imbued feel.

‘Firebreath’, with its piano led tune, reminds us of Little Earthquakes era Tori Amos. It is a haunting and melodic pop tune that gives us an insight into an exciting new talent. The video is rather fine as well.

Video of the week #1: Bowerbirds ‘Overcome with Light’

Bowerbirds are fast becoming my musical find of the year. The album, ‘The Clearing’ is a beautiful thing, their live show in Brighton was excellent and now they have a very cool video for ‘Overcome with Light’. I hope you enjoy as much as I do.
